A PAIR of young boxers from The Priory School in Orpington enjoyed success at the national junior ABA championship finals.
Ted Cheeseman, 16, won all six bouts on the his way to victory in a 29-6 triumph over Tion Gibbs in the final.
βItβs another step on a road which I hope will lead to Rio 2016,β said Cheeseman, who runs every morning before school.
And fellow Priory student 17-year-old Dan Woledge overcame a tough orthodox boxer in Cyrus Patterson 39-20 in his first national final.
